Gooey Salted Caramel Chocolate Chip Cookie Bars Recipe

These Gooey Salted Caramel Chocolate Chip Cookie Bars feature a perfect balance of sweet and salty flavors with soft, chewy cookie layers and a luscious caramel filling. Topped with flaky sea salt, they are an irresistible treat ideal for dessert or snack time.

Ingredients

Scale

Dry Ingredients

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 tsp baking soda
  • 0.5 tsp salt

Wet Ingredients

  • 0.75 cup unsalted butter (softened)
  • 1 cup brown sugar (packed)
  • 0.5 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 2 tsp vanilla extract

Add-ins & Topping

  • 1.5 cups chocolate chips
  • 1 cup thick caramel sauce
  • Flaky sea salt (for topping)

Instructions

  1. Preheat and Prepare: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king pan with parchment paper for easy removal and cleanup.
  2. Mix Dry Ingredients: In a medium b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king soda, and salt until well combined.
  3. Cream Butter and Sugars: In a separate large bowl, use an electric mixer to cream the softened unsalted butter with brown sugar and granulated sugar until the mixture is light and fluffy, about 3-4 minutes.
  4. Add Eggs and Vanilla: Beat in the eggs one at a time, then stir in the vanilla extract, ensuring everything is fully incorporated.
  5. Combine Wet and Dry: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, mixing just until combined. Avoid overmixing to keep the bars tender.
  6. Fold in Chocolate Chips: Gently fold the chocolate chips into the cookie dough ensuring even distribution.
  7. Layer Dough and Caramel: Spread half of the cookie dough evenly into the prepared pan. Pour the thick caramel sauce over the dough and then dollop the remaining cookie dough on top, spreading gently to cover the caramel layer.
  8. Bake: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es or until the edges are set and golden but the center remains soft and slightly gooey.
  9. Add Flaky Sea Salt and Cool: Immediately after removing from the oven, sprinkle flaky sea salt evenly over the top. Allow the bars to cool completely in the pan before slicing into squares.

Notes

  • Use thick caramel sauce for a rich and gooey middle layer; homemade or store-bought both work well.
  • Ensure the butter is softened to room temperature for better creaming and texture.
  • Do not overbake; the center should remain soft to maintain gooeyness.
  • For easier slicing, chill the bars after cooling to firm up the caramel layer.
  • Flaky sea salt enhances the caramel flavor by adding a subtle crunch and a burst of saltiness.
